Understanding Different Types of Garage Door Springs

When it comes to choosing the right garage door springs, understanding the different types available is crucial. Garage door springs are essential components that ensure the smooth operation of your garage door. They counterbalance the weight of the door, making it easy to open and close. There are two main types of garage door springs: torsion springs and extension springs. Each type has its own set of characteristics, advantages, and disadvantages. Torsion Springs

Torsion springs are the most common type of garage door springs used in modern garage doors. They are typically mounted horizontally above the garage door opening. These springs work by twisting and storing mechanical energy when the door is closed, which is then released to lift the door.

Characteristics of Torsion Springs

  1. Durability: Torsion springs are known for their durability and longevity. They can last between 15,000 to 20,000 cycles, which translates to approximately 7-10 years of use, depending on how frequently the garage door is operated.
  2. Smooth Operation: These springs provide a smoother and more controlled operation compared to extension springs. This is because they distribute the weight of the door evenly, reducing wear and tear on other components.
  3. Safety: Torsion springs are generally safer than extension springs. They are less likely to snap and cause injury because they are installed on a shaft and are under less tension.

Advantages of Torsion Springs

  • Longevity: As mentioned earlier, torsion springs have a longer lifespan, making them a cost-effective option in the long run.
  • Efficiency: They offer a more efficient lifting mechanism, which reduces strain on the garage door opener.
  • Safety: The risk of sudden breakage is minimized, enhancing overall safety.

Disadvantages of Torsion Springs

  • Cost: Torsion springs are generally more expensive than extension springs. However, their durability often justifies the higher initial cost.
  • Installation Complexity: Installing torsion springs can be more complex and may require professional assistance.

Extension Springs

Extension springs are typically mounted on either side of the garage door track. They work by extending and contracting to counterbalance the weight of the door. These springs are more common in older garage door systems.

Characteristics of Extension Springs

  1. Cost-Effective: Extension springs are usually less expensive than torsion springs, making them a popular choice for budget-conscious homeowners.
  2. Simple Design: Their straightforward design makes them easier to install and replace.
  3. High Tension: Extension springs operate under high tension, which can pose safety risks if they break.

Advantages of Extension Springs

  • Affordability: They are generally more affordable, making them a good option for those on a tight budget.
  • Ease of Installation: Their simpler design allows for easier installation and replacement, which can often be done without professional help.

Disadvantages of Extension Springs

  • Safety Concerns: Due to the high tension they operate under, extension springs can be dangerous if they snap. Safety cables are often recommended to mitigate this risk.
  • Shorter Lifespan: They typically have a shorter lifespan compared to torsion springs, lasting around 10,000 cycles or 5-7 years of use.
  • Less Smooth Operation: The operation of extension springs is generally less smooth, which can lead to more wear and tear on the garage door system.

Choosing the Right Type of Spring

When deciding between torsion and extension springs, consider the following factors:

  1. Budget: If cost is a primary concern, extension springs may be the better option. However, if you can afford a higher initial investment, torsion springs offer better long-term value.
  2. Usage: For high-usage garage doors, torsion springs are the better choice due to their durability and efficiency.
  3. Safety: If safety is a top priority, torsion springs are generally safer and more reliable.
  4. Professional Installation: If you prefer to handle installation yourself, extension springs are easier to install. However, for the best performance and safety, professional installation of torsion springs is recommended.

Factors to Consider When Selecting Garage Door Springs

When it comes to maintaining the functionality and safety of your garage door, selecting the right garage door springs is crucial. Garage door springs are essential components that bear the weight of the door and facilitate its smooth operation. Choosing the wrong type or size can lead to operational issues, safety hazards, and increased maintenance costs. Here are several key factors to consider when selecting garage door springs to ensure you make an informed decision.

1. Type of Garage Door Springs

There are primarily two types of garage door springs: torsion springs and extension springs. Each type has its own set of advantages and is suited for different kinds of garage doors.

  • Torsion Springs: These are mounted above the garage door and use torque to lift the door. They are generally more durable and provide smoother operation compared to extension springs. Torsion springs are ideal for heavier and larger doors. They also offer better balance and are safer because they are less likely to snap.

  • Extension Springs: These are mounted on either side of the door and extend to open it. They are typically used for lighter and smaller garage doors. While they are less expensive than torsion springs, they are also less durable and can be more dangerous if they break.

2. Weight and Size of the Garage Door

The weight and size of your garage door are critical factors in determining the appropriate spring type and size. A spring that is too weak will not be able to lift the door properly, while a spring that is too strong can cause the door to open too quickly and potentially damage the door or opener.

  • Weight: Measure the weight of your garage door using a scale. This will help you determine the spring’s load capacity. Most manufacturers provide a weight range for their springs, so make sure to choose one that matches your door’s weight.

  • Size: The size of the door, including its height and width, will also influence the type of spring you need. Larger doors generally require more robust springs.

3. Spring Length and Wire Size

The length of the spring and the diameter of the wire used in the spring are also important considerations.

  • Spring Length: The length of the spring affects the amount of tension it can provide. A longer spring can stretch more and provide more lift, but it also needs to be matched correctly to the door’s weight and size.

  • Wire Size: The diameter of the wire used in the spring affects its strength and durability. Thicker wire can handle more weight and last longer, but it also requires more force to stretch.

4. Cycle Life

The cycle life of a garage door spring refers to the number of times the spring can open and close the door before it needs to be replaced. Standard springs typically have a cycle life of around 10,000 cycles, but high-cycle springs can last up to 50,000 cycles or more.

  • Usage Frequency: Consider how often you use your garage door. If you use it multiple times a day, investing in high-cycle springs can save you money and hassle in the long run.

5. Material Quality

The quality of the material used in the spring can significantly impact its durability and performance. Springs made from high-quality steel are generally more reliable and have a longer lifespan.

  • Coating and Finish: Some springs come with a protective coating or finish to prevent rust and corrosion. This is particularly important if you live in an area with high humidity or salt in the air.

6. Safety Features

Safety should always be a top priority when selecting garage door springs. Look for springs that come with safety features such as:

  • Safety Cables: These are essential for extension springs to prevent them from flying off if they break.
  • Spring Containment: Some torsion springs come with a containment system to prevent broken pieces from causing injury.

7. Professional Installation

While it might be tempting to install the springs yourself to save money, professional installation is highly recommended. Garage door springs are under high tension and can cause serious injury if not handled properly.

  • Expertise: Professionals have the expertise to select the right springs and install them safely.
  • Warranty: Many professional installations come with a warranty, providing peace of mind and protection against future issues.

8. Cost Considerations

While cost should not be the sole factor in your decision, it is still an important consideration. High-quality springs with a longer cycle life and better safety features may cost more upfront but can save you money in the long run by reducing maintenance and replacement costs.

  • Budget: Determine your budget and look for springs that offer the best value within that range.
  • Long-term Savings: Consider the long-term savings of investing in high-quality, durable springs.

9. Compatibility with Garage Door Opener

Ensure that the springs you choose are compatible with your garage door opener. Some springs may require specific types of openers or additional adjustments to work correctly.

  • Manufacturer Recommendations: Check the manufacturer’s recommendations for both the springs and the opener to ensure compatibility.

10. Customer Reviews and Testimonials

Before making a final decision, read customer reviews and testimonials to get an idea of the performance and reliability of the springs you are considering. This can provide valuable insights into potential issues and the overall satisfaction of other users.

  • Reputable Sources: Look for reviews on reputable websites and forums to ensure they are genuine and unbiased.
